How Does Seeing Previously Downloaded Apps Actually Work?
At its core, the ability to view past app downloads relies on built-in system features and privacy settings on most modern mobile devices. On Android and iOS, apps automatically store metadata when downloaded, including installation date, developer, and user interaction. This data is typically available through device settings or companion apps, offering a transparent log of app history.
Some manufacturers and privacy tools provide summary dashboards that consolidate this information, filtering by install date or usage patterns. These built-in or third-party insights empower users without requiring deep technical knowledge—enabling better control over digital environments in a secure, compliant way.
